温馨提示×

Debian域名安全防护怎么做

小樊
41
2025-03-06 22:18:40
栏目: 云计算
Debian服务器限时活动,0元免费领,库存有限,领完即止! 点击查看>>

Debian域名安全防护涉及多个方面,包括配置DNS记录、使用防火墙、安装安全工具、更新系统和软件包等。以下是一些关键步骤和最佳实践:

1. 配置DNS记录

  • A记录:将域名指向服务器的IP地址。
  • CNAME记录:将域名指向另一个域名(如将www.example.com指向example.com)。
  • MX记录:指定邮件服务器的地址。
  • TXT记录:用于验证域名所有权或其他用途。

2. 使用防火墙

  • 安装和配置 ufw(Uncomplicated Firewall)来限制访问。
  • 设置防火墙规则,仅允许必要的端口(如SSH的22端口)进出。
sudo apt update
sudo apt install ufw
sudo ufw allow OpenSSH
sudo ufw enable

3. 安装安全工具

  • SSH密钥配置:生成SSH密钥对,使用SSH密钥进行身份验证,禁用root登录。
ssh-keygen
ssh-copyid username@remote_host
  • 定期更新系统:使用 apt updateapt upgrade 命令确保系统中的软件包都是最新的。

4. 禁用不必要的服务和端口

  • 检查系统中运行的服务,禁用或卸载非必需的服务和进程,以减少攻击面。

5. 使用SmartDNS和AdGuard Home

  • 自建DNS服务器,使用SmartDNS和AdGuard Home解决DNS污染和泄露问题。

6. 配置Web服务器

  • 如果使用Nginx或Apache等Web服务器,确保配置正确,仅允许必要的HTTP/HTTPS流量。
server {
    listen 80;
    server_name example.com www.example.com;
    root /var/www/example.com;
    index index.html index.htm;
    location / {
        try_files uri uri/ 404;
    }
}

7. 监控和日志管理

  • 利用监控工具(如Nagios、Zabbix)监控系统状态,及时发现异常活动。
  • 确保所有的登录尝试和服务活动都被记录到日志文件中,并定期检查日志文件以发现异常行为。

8. 数据备份与恢复策略

  • 定期备份服务器的关键数据,并存储在安全的地点。
  • 建立灾难恢复计划,以防万一发生安全事件或数据丢失时能够迅速恢复。

通过以上措施,可以显著提高Debian系统的安全性,保护域名免受各种网络威胁。

亿速云「云服务器」,即开即用、新一代英特尔至强铂金CPU、三副本存储NVMe SSD云盘,价格低至29元/月。点击查看>>

推荐阅读:Debian安全防护怎么做

0